JUST HAD A LOOK ON THE SNFC WEBSITE AT EVERY RACE (2-3 RACES MISSING FROM SITE)FROM 2005 TO THE CURRENT AND HAVE ADDED ALL POSITIONS WON IN THE TOP TEN OPEN AND WHAT SECTION THESE WINNING BIRDS FLY INTO,I HAVE NOT INCLUDED BIRDAGES,MEMBERS,SECTION SIZES ETC JUST THE AMOUNT OF TOP TEN OPEN FINISHES FOR EACH SECTION.DID GET A SLIGHT EYE OPENER BUT NOT UNEXPECTED,HOPE THIS IS OF SOME INTEREST. :) :) :)

 

SECTION A = 124 TOP TEN OPEN POSITIONS.

SECTION B = 171 " " " " "

SECTION C = 82 " " " " "

SECTION D = 31 " " " " "

SECTION E = 26 " " " " "

SECTION F = 3 " " " " "

SECTION G = 10 " " " " "
